69. Deputy Brendan Smith asked the Tánaiste and Minister for Foreign Affairs and Trade if he has had discussions with his British counterpart on the legislation being enacted or proposed by the British Government regarding its decision to exit the European Union; and if he has satisfied himself that such legislation does not impact on aspects of the Good Friday Agreement. [52941/17]
